News & Blog

Best Practices for WooCommerce Security and Maintenance

WooCommerce is one of the most popular e-commerce platforms in the world, and for good reason — it’s flexible, powerful, and user-friendly. However, with great popularity comes great risk. WooCommerce stores are frequent targets for cyberattacks, data breaches, and performance issues if not properly maintained.

At Back Story Global, we specialize in building and maintaining secure, high-performing WooCommerce stores that help businesses grow safely. In this blog, we’ll walk you through the best practices for WooCommerce security and maintenance so you can protect your investment and offer a seamless experience to your customers.

1. Keep WooCommerce, WordPress, and Plugins Updated

Updates aren’t just about new features — they’re critical for security.
Outdated plugins, themes, and core files are the most common vulnerabilities hackers exploit.
Always keep your WordPress core, WooCommerce plugin, and all other themes/plugins updated to their latest versions.

At Back Story Global, we recommend scheduling weekly update checks and testing updates in a staging environment before going live.

2. Use Strong Passwords and Two-Factor Authentication

Simple passwords are an open invitation to hackers.
Use strong, unique passwords for all administrator accounts, and encourage your users to do the same. Better yet, implement Two-Factor Authentication (2FA) for all admin and customer login pages.

There are many reliable WordPress plugins, such as Wordfence or iThemes Security, that make setting up 2FA easy.

3. Implement Secure Hosting and SSL Certificates

Your store’s hosting environment plays a huge role in its security.
Choose a reputable hosting provider that specializes in WordPress and WooCommerce hosting. Features like daily backups, malware scanning, firewall protection, and DDoS mitigation are essential.

And don’t forget: always install and maintain an active SSL certificate. It encrypts sensitive customer data and is a major ranking factor for SEO.

4. Regularly Backup Your Website

Even with the best security measures, accidents can happen. Regular backups ensure you can quickly restore your store if something goes wrong.
Set up automatic daily backups of your entire website — database, media files, and all. Make sure your backup files are stored securely off-site.

At Back Story Global, we recommend using trusted backup solutions like UpdraftPlus, BlogVault, or BackupBuddy for WooCommerce stores.

5. Limit User Access and Roles

Not everyone needs full access to your website. Assign appropriate user roles and limit admin access only to essential personnel.
WooCommerce has built-in role management features — use them wisely.
Also, regularly audit user accounts to ensure there are no outdated or unused accounts lingering.

6. Monitor Site Activity and Security Logs

Monitoring your site can help you spot suspicious activities early.
Install plugins like WP Activity Log to keep track of changes in user accounts, orders, plugins, and settings.

At Back Story Global, we recommend setting up real-time alerts so you are immediately notified of any unusual activities.

7. Optimize for Performance and Regular Maintenance

Security isn’t just about protecting against hackers — a slow website can also drive customers away and hurt your SEO.

  • Optimize images and media files.
  • Use a reliable caching plugin.
  • Clean your database regularly.
  • Minimize plugin bloat.

Schedule regular maintenance checks to identify and fix performance issues before they become major problems.

Final Thoughts

Running a WooCommerce store successfully means prioritizing security and consistent maintenance. These best practices can save you from costly breaches, downtime, and reputation damage.

At Back Story Global, we are committed to helping businesses secure and optimize their WooCommerce platforms. Whether you’re setting up a new store or need professional maintenance support, our team is here to ensure your site remains fast, secure, and ready for growth.

Ready to strengthen your WooCommerce store?
📞 Contact us today or visit www.backstoryglobal.com to learn how we can help.

Backstory Global

Leave a comment

Your email address will not be published. Required fields are marked *

Back Story started in 2020, offering end-to-end software and web development solutions.

Back Story started in 2020, offering end-to-end software and web development solutions.

© 2025 Backstory Global All Rights Reserved.